Shell index accuracy
Shell Index refers to the house price index calculated by Shell Housing based on big data analysis and algorithmic modeling. It is based on the statistics and analysis of the massive housing information and transaction data on the Shell Housing platform. Shell index can better reflect the current trend and change of housing prices in the city or region.

However, it should be noted that the Shell Index is only a reference. The rise and fall of house prices are affected by many factors, including supply and demand, economic situation, policy regulation and so on. Shell index can only provide a relative trend of house price, for specific house price prediction and investment decision also need to consider other factors.

In addition, the accuracy of Shell Index is also related to the authenticity and completeness of the data. If the data collection is incomplete or biased, then the accuracy of the Shell Index will also be affected. Therefore, when using the Shell Index, you need to identify the source and quality of the data and combine it with other information to make a judgment.

In summary, the Shell Index provides a reference, but cannot fully and accurately predict home price trends. When making home purchase or investment decisions, it is recommended to consider all factors and seek advice from professionals or organizations.
